The Nonwoven Tape market is a segment of the Adhesives and Sealants industry. Nonwoven Tape is a type of adhesive tape made from nonwoven fabric, which is a fabric-like material made from fibers that are bonded together. Nonwoven Tape is used in a variety of applications, including automotive, medical, and industrial. It is often used to provide a secure bond between two surfaces, and can be used to seal, protect, and insulate. Nonwoven Tape is available in a variety of sizes, colors, and adhesion levels, and can be customized to meet specific needs.
